Why do people dress nice to the airport?
Passengers and some psychologists believe that if people dress up before their flight, they might be more respectful – and less likely to lash out. “When people dress better, they tend to behave better,” said Thomas Plante, a psychology professor at Santa Clara University. “A dress code might help.”
Is it OK to wear jeans on a plane?
Ditch your jeans “This means gas expands, including any gas we may have in our gut.” Cue feeling bloated and uncomfortable in your seat, something the tight waistband of jeans won’t help. “It’s always sensible to wear comfortable bottoms with a stretchy waistband,” says Shotter.

What clothes not to wear to the airport?
For example, you don’t want to wear any clothes with offensive or threatening material—while the TSA may let you through, you could be denied boarding by an airline. And you don’t want to wear baggy clothes: while this isn’t expressly prohibited, it could extend the length of time you’re with airport security.
What shouldn’t you wear to the airport?
At most airports, security is strict about shoes—especially styles with chunky soles that could theoretically hide items or high-top sneakers that cover the ankle. Metal details such as studs or buckles also often set off the alarm.
Should you dress nice for the airport?
While dressing smartly is key, avoid excessive jewelry or accessories that could set off metal detectors. Additionally, stay away from clothing that might impede your comfort during long flights, such as skinny jeans that restrict movement.
Is it okay to wear baggy clothes to the airport?
While baggy clothing isn’t prohibited, TSA rules and regulations may require you to undergo extra screening if they cannot clear you as safe to travel.

First and foremost, comfort is key. You’re going to be doing a lot of walking, standing in lines, and sitting for long periods of time, so you want to wear clothes that won’t restrict your movement or leave you feeling uncomfortable. Opt for loose, breathable fabrics like cotton or linen. Avoid anything too tight or binding.
In terms of specific clothing items, I’d recommend wearing pants or leggings rather than shorts or a skirt. You’ll be glad to have a little more coverage, especially when going through security. Speaking of security, you’ll also want to steer clear of anything with metal components, like jeans with metallic buttons or embellishments. Those can set off the metal detectors and cause delays.
For your top, a simple t-shirt or tank top is a great choice. Layers are also a good idea, like a light cardigan or jacket that you can easily take on and off. That way you can adjust your outfit as needed, whether it’s getting chilly on the plane or feeling overheated in the terminal.
Don’t forget to consider your footwear as well. Comfortable, slip-on shoes are ideal. You’ll be taking them off and putting them back on repeatedly at security, so lace-up sneakers or boots can be a hassle. Flats, loafers, or sandals are perfect. Just make sure they have a sturdy sole that will hold up to a lot of walking.
In addition to your main outfit, there are a few other clothing and accessory tips to keep in mind for the airport:
- Wear socks! You’ll need them when going through security.
- Bring an extra layer like a scarf or shawl. Airplanes can get chilly.
- Avoid wearing a belt if possible. That’s one more thing you’ll have to remove for the metal detectors.
- Skip the jewelry, watches, and other metallic accessories.
- Carry a small purse or bag that’s easy to take on and off. Avoid large totes or backpacks.
The goal is to dress in a way that’s practical, comfortable, and won’t cause any hassles at the airport. You want to be able to breeze through security and get to your gate without any issues.
